Cleveland: University Circle (General): Development and News
The situation is just completely in flux as far as materials are concerned. Suppliers used to issue a guaranteed cost for a specific time frame, generally to the completion date of the project. Right now, suppliers will give you a price quote that’s “good” for 30 days, but won’t actually bill until the materials are shipped. If the price is higher at that point, sorry about your luck!

Brecksville: Valor Acres Development
The project goes out for bid in mid-October. Expecting a January start for construction. The new (full) interchange and widened I-77 southbound to SR-21 will be completed by October 2023.
